Step 1: Assessment and Water Extraction
Our technicians will arrive at your property and assess the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and structural damage.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our technicians will use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ry your property. We’ll also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
After the drying process is complete, our technicians will clean and sanitize your property to remove any remaining bacteria or mold.
Step 4: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, our technicians will work with you to restore your property to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ged materials, such as drywall or flooring.

Warning Signs You Need Sink Overflow Water Removal
Ignoring the signs of a sink overflow can lead to costly repairs down the line. That’s why it’s essential to catch these warning signs early and take action. Here are some common signs that you need Sink Overflow Water Removal: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of mold growth. If you notice musty smells that won’t go away, it’s time to call in the professionals.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leak or overflow. If you notice water stains,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action.
Bubbling or Cracking Walls
Bubbling or cracking wal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s time to call in the professionals.
Unpleasant Sounds from Your Pipes
Unpleasant sounds from your pipes can be a sign of a leak or overflow. If you notice strange noises,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s time to call in the professionals.
Excessive Moisture in Your Home
Excessive moisture in your home can be a sign of a leak or overflow. If you notice high humidity levels,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action.
Sink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ak with minimal damage |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ak and clean up the mess yourself. |
| Large leak with extensive damage |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to handle the cleanup and restoration. |
| Unknown source of the leak | No | Yes | You’ll need a professional to investigate the source and provide a solution. |
| High-risk area, such as a kitchen or bathroom | No | Yes | You’ll need a professional to ensure the area is safe and properly restored. |
| Insurance claim involved | No | Yes | A professional will work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process. |
| Time-sensitive situation, such as a burst pipe during a holiday | No | Yes | A professional will work quickly and efficiently to get your property back to normal. |
